Budget Analysts
Budget Analyst,
Budget and Policy Analyst,
Budget Officer,
Budget Planning Analyst
What they do: Examine budget estimates for completeness, accuracy, and conformance with procedures and regulations. Analyze budgeting and accounting reports.

What do they typically do on the job?
- Analyze monthly department budgeting and accounting reports to maintain expenditure controls.
- Provide advice and technical assistance with cost analysis, fiscal allocation, and budget preparation.
- Review operating budgets to analyze trends affecting budget needs.
